Factors Affecting Your 1991 Miata Insurance Premiums
When it comes to determining your 1991 Mazda Miata insurance cost, insurance companies look at a variety of factors. It's not just about the car itself; your personal profile plays a significant role too.
Driver Profile
Your driving history is a major factor. Got a clean record? Awesome! You’re likely to get lower rates. But if you’ve had accidents or speeding tickets, expect to pay more. Insurance companies see you as a higher risk, and that translates to higher premiums. Your age and experience also matter. Younger drivers, especially those under 25, typically face higher insurance rates because they're statistically more likely to be involved in accidents. On the flip side, experienced drivers with years of safe driving under their belts usually get better deals. Where you live also impacts your insurance rates. Urban areas with higher traffic density and theft rates tend to have pricier insurance than rural areas. Even your credit score can influence your insurance premiums in many states. A good credit score often leads to lower rates, while a poor credit score can hike up your costs.
Vehicle Factors
The 1991 Mazda Miata is a classic, but its age and condition affect insurance costs. Older cars might be cheaper to insure because they're not worth as much, but finding parts for repairs can be a hassle, potentially increasing costs. The Miata's safety features (or lack thereof, compared to modern cars) also play a role. Newer cars come with advanced safety tech that can reduce accident severity, which translates to lower insurance rates. The Miata, being an older model, might not have these features, potentially increasing your premiums. How you use your Miata matters too. If it's a weekend cruiser, you'll likely pay less than if it's your daily driver. Insurance companies consider the mileage you clock annually when calculating your rates.
Coverage Type
The type of coverage you choose significantly impacts your insurance cost. Liability coverage, which covers damages you cause to others, is usually the minimum required by law. Collision coverage pays for damage to your Miata if you're at fault in an accident, while comprehensive coverage protects against things like theft, vandalism, and natural disasters. Adding these coverages will increase your premium but offers more peace of mind. The deductible you choose also plays a role. A higher deductible means you pay more out-of-pocket in case of an accident, but it lowers your monthly premium. Conversely, a lower deductible means you pay less out-of-pocket, but your monthly premium will be higher. Consider what you can comfortably afford when choosing your deductible.
Average Insurance Costs for a 1991 Mazda Miata
Alright, let's get down to the numbers! Keep in mind that these are just averages, and your actual insurance cost can vary quite a bit based on the factors we just discussed. Generally, you might expect to pay anywhere from $800 to $1500 per year for full coverage on a 1991 Mazda Miata. Liability-only coverage could be cheaper, perhaps in the $400 to $800 range annually. However, remember that liability-only coverage doesn't protect your own vehicle.
State Variations
Insurance rates vary significantly by state due to different regulations and risk factors. States with higher population densities, more traffic, and a greater likelihood of natural disasters tend to have higher insurance rates. For example, you might pay more in California or Florida than you would in a rural state like Montana or Idaho. Always check your local state laws to understand the minimum required coverage and how it affects your premium.

Classic Car Insurance for Your 1991 Miata
Since your 1991 Mazda Miata is now a classic, you might want to consider classic car insurance. This type of insurance is specifically designed for vintage and classic vehicles and often offers better rates and coverage options than standard auto insurance. Classic car insurance typically has mileage restrictions, so it's best if you only drive your Miata occasionally. However, it can provide specialized coverage tailored to the unique needs of classic car owners.
Benefits of Classic Car Insurance
One of the main benefits of classic car insurance is that it often provides agreed-value coverage. This means that if your Miata is totaled, you'll receive the agreed-upon value of the car, rather than the actual cash value, which can be significantly lower. Classic car insurance also often includes coverage for spare parts and restoration work, which can be invaluable if you're restoring your Miata. Plus, classic car insurance companies often have expertise in dealing with vintage vehicles, so they can provide better customer service and support.
